You will be collected from your accommodation after breakfast and transferred to Llangynidr to begin your walk. It’s going to be strenuous, but rewarding. The views are incredible as you move up through woods onto the ridge overlooking Talybont Reservoir. Test your legs again on Craig y Fan Ddu before reaching Pen y Fan. You can detour slightly to Fan y Big for a photo opportunity at the ‘Diving Board’ rock. As you descend Pen y Fan down to Storey Arms, our driver will meet you and return you to Brecon for a well-earned rest.

Today you escape the busier parts of the Beacons Way; the route is slightly kinder on the knees as you head to the summit of Craig Cerrig-gleisiad and the ridge of Fan Dringarth and Fan Llia. You may even have the whole area to yourself. Descend Fan Llia down to Sarn Helen - a Roman road, whilst underneath your feet lies a major cave system and rare limestone pavement. You will walk through the Ogof Ffynnon Ddu National Nature Reserve before ending the day at Craig-y-nos Country Park where our driver will meet you once again and return your accommodation.If you prefer to travel home at the end of day two, rather than stay another night, choose itinerary BW-BRE2
